Human Development, Family Studies, and Related Services Program 2024 Tuition

In the United States, 1,211 colleges are offering Human Development, Family Studies, and Related Services programs. The 2024 average undergraduate tuition & fees of the Human Development, Family Studies, and Related Services program is $10,506 for state residents and $27,015 for out-of-state students. 825 colleges are offering human-development-family-studies-and-related-services certificate or associate's degree programs.
The average salary after completing the Human Development, Family Studies, and Related Services program is $34,164 with a bachelor's degree (or undergraduate certificate) and $46,637 with a master degree (or higher).

Average Salary after Completing Human Development, Family Studies, and Related Services Program

The following table shows the average earning of students three years after completing the Human Development, Family Studies, and Related Services program by degree type. The average earning after graduation is $34,164 for bachelor's degree and $46,637 for master degree programs.
DegreeAverage EarningAverage Loan Debt
Undergraduate Certificate or Diploma$18,716-
Associate's Degree$22,648$17,366
Bachelor's Degree$34,164$23,021
Master's Degree$46,637$38,953
Doctoral Degree$65,989-
Graduate/Professional Certificate$44,162$50,332
